Does one PRI key enable all the PRI cards in the system? Or is one key required for each card?

My independent Norstar tech told me I needed one code for each card, so as I bought each card, I got an enabler code to go with it. Three DTI cards, three PRI enabler keys.

I was just told by a Norstar vendor that I need only one key to enable all three cards. (I've got another post about lossing my PRI codes after the system defauled.)

Have I been like the military and bought something that I didn't really need? ;-)
 
Tech is wrong, vendor is correct
